From c96a3585935f8fb064fd40828447ba862f86ff5b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Andrew Gallant Date: Sat, 21 Jul 2018 17:50:54 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] ripgrep: add warning to --pre flag The --pre flag can result in a pretty large performance penalty, so put a warning in the flag documentation. This warning is important because a flag like this could easily wind up in a user's configuration file. --- src/app.rs | 4 ++++ 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+) diff --git a/src/app.rs b/src/app.rs index 67b7295..6344f53 100644 --- a/src/app.rs +++ b/src/app.rs @@ -1473,6 +1473,10 @@ contents of FILE. This option expects the COMMAND program to either be an absolute path or to be available in your PATH. An empty string COMMAND deactivates this feature. +WARNING: When this flag is set, ripgrep will unconditionally spawn a process +for every file that is searched. Therefore, this can incur a large performance +penalty if you don't otherwise need the flexibility offered by this flag. + A preprocessor is not run when ripgrep is searching stdin.
